Orissa assembly winter session ends abruptly

Bhubaneswar, Dec 5 : Orissa Speaker Pradip Amat abruptly adjourned the state assembly session Saturday, 14 days short of its scheduled duration.

The speaker declared the house adjourned sine die after ruling Biju Janata Dal (BJD) chief whip Rabi Narayan Pani moved a motion that there was no pending official business and the house should be adjourned. The motion was supported by ruling party members.

The opposition members, however, protested the decision and described it as "undemocratic". They staged a protest near the speaker's podium even after the adjournment.

They said they will continue to hold protests in the house.

"It is an unfortunate development. It is a Black day for parliamentary democracy," Leader of Opposition Bhupinder Singh said.

The winter session of the assembly commenced Nov 18 and was scheduled to conclude Dec 19.
